NoSQL databases in many cases are really rapidly, tend not to require mounted table schemas, stay clear of sign up for functions by storing denormalized info, and so are made to scale horizontally.

The perform 'COALESCE' can simplify dealing with null values. by way of example, to stay away from displaying null values by dealing with null as zero, you can sort:

Software software package can normally access a database on behalf of end-customers, without exposing the DBMS interface directly. Application programmers may perhaps utilize a wire protocol right, or even more very likely by means of an application programming interface.

This can be managed specifically on a person foundation, or via the assignment of people and privileges to teams, or (in by far the most elaborate products) with the assignment of individuals and teams to roles which might be then granted entitlements. Information security helps prevent unauthorized users from viewing or updating the database. Utilizing passwords, consumers are allowed use of the complete database or subsets of it termed "subschemas".

Considering the fact that DBMSs comprise a substantial sector, Computer system and storage suppliers normally take note of DBMS requirements in their particular advancement plans.[seven]

NB when wrapping Python's conditional build into a utility functionality, the unalterably keen nature of the more intuitive language construct for side-impact features

can make reference to any column that was established earlier in a worth checklist. Such as, you can do this as the price for col2 refers to col1, which has Earlier been assigned:

The 3-degree database architecture relates to the thought of information independence which was one of the main Preliminary driving forces with the Visit This Link relational design. The thought is improvements produced at a certain stage tend not to have an effect on the look at at a higher level.

Benefit is actually a synonym for VALUES With this context. Neither indicates just about anything about the quantity of values lists, nor about the volume of values for each listing. Both could possibly be made use of regardless of whether There's a one values listing or numerous lists, and regardless of the number of values for every record.

A parallel database seeks to improve performance by parallelization for jobs including loading information, setting up indexes and analyzing queries.

Considering that the next statements give little or no specifics of sights, if you should get metadata about them you'll probably choose to question the VIEWS desk.

An embedded database technique is a DBMS and that is tightly built-in by having an application software package that requires entry to stored info in such a way which the DBMS is concealed from the application's stop-end users and involves little if any ongoing servicing.[26]

